Answer:

There is a total 50 questions.

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x = total questions in the exam

Since 82% of the test was scored correctly, that means 18% of the student's exam was scored incorrectly.

With this information we can write:

[tex]18\%x=9[/tex] (Given that the student made 9 mistakes)

[tex]x=9\div18\%[/tex] (divide 18% on both sides)

[tex]x=50[/tex]

∴ There was a total of 50 questions in the examination.
